1 John. 3:11-24, 4:7-21

Genuine love is fast fading out among men. Selfishness is fast encroaching into the fabric of society. To profess to others that, we love them is easy. To live it as a lifestyle is where the work is. The passage above shows us the pattern of the life God wants for us as His children to live. God is only asking us to become who He is. i.e. Like Father…like son/ daughter.

True demonstration of selfless love and unity is a reflection of the depth of God we know. We cannot claim we love God when we don’t manifest this in practical terms to others God sent our way. Most marriages and relationship that fail over time can be traced to selfishness and manifestation of pride. You don’t love your spouse because it is the easiest of things to do. You do so because it’s a command of the kind of life Christ expect us to live. Don’t forget that the devil will attack wherever love and unity abide. The forces of nature further encourage human beings to be selfish. However, the word of God which is the balance to live states love must be upheld.

The devil saw how God loved the world that He gave His only begotten son that, whosoever believes in Him should not perish but have everlasting life. [John 3:16] so the rage and attack to nail Him to the cross came full-force. If he had known that by nailing Jesus to the cross that victory would be shared to the entirely world, he wouldn’t have done it. So, loving others according to the directive of the Holy Spirit has deeper and greater outcome for you in the nearest future.

Be that careful Christian that will not permit the devil/flesh to dictate when to love or stop loving others in the Christian fold. Don’t be that person who will pull others down with negative words. Let your words be seasoned with salt, edifying the body of Christ.

Loving those who love us can be comfortable but loving those who despitefully use us is a serious work that only the empowerment of the Spirit of God in us can make happen. It might be rare to find around us but aim at this.
